See incredible snowdrops at Warwick's historic gardens at 'winter spectacle'

Over 140 varieties of snowdrops will be on display at historic gardens in Warwick this February.

The annual Snowdrop Weekend will be marked at Hill Close Gardens on Saturday 31 January and Sunday 1 February.

The "winter spectacle" will take place across 16 "beautifully restored" Victorian gardens.

Organisers said: "See Hill Close Gardens in its most atmospheric season, when frost-kissed paths lead to drifts of snowdrops glowing against the winter earth.

"These delicate blooms are nature's early promise, and here they tell a story rooted in centuries of horticultural passion."

Previously the event has been endorsed by the Daily Telegraph and by House and Garden magazine.

On display over the weekend will be 'Warwickshire Gemini' - a snowdrop with a twist.

Often producing two elegant flowers per bulb, this local cultivar is a favourite among collectors.
